我想问你如何进行如下查询:
select * from table where id = 1 AND year = 1999
Android中用sqlite的命令查询? 提前致谢
最佳答案
只需将“AND”添加到第三个参数(字符串选择
):
database.query(TABLE_NAME, new String[]{COLUMN_1, COLUMN_2},
COLUMN_1 + " = ? AND " + COLUMN_2 + " = ? ", new String[]{value1, value2}, null, null, null);
就您而言,COLUMN_1
是 id
,COLUMN_2
是 year
,value1
> 是“1”
,value2
是“1999”
。
关于Android sqlite 查询与 AND,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/30211859/